Recent advances in intelligent water meter technology have improved the quantitative monitoring in water supply and distribution systems. Smart meters using automated meter reading (AMR) technology allow water utilities to: (a) provide clear consumption patterns which can help customers to track and control their water usage and (b) improve active leakage targeting and leak detection capability. This paper presents a feedback about the use of AMR system to detect leakage in a large-scale experimentation, which is conducted at the Scientific Campus of the University of Lille, which stands for a small town of 25,000 users. This paper presents the demonstration site as well as its monitoring using AMR technology and how this technology allowed a rapid detection of water leakage.
